Etymology 1[edit]

Root
ص و ر (ṣ-w-r)

Derived from the active participle of صَوَّرَ (ṣawwara, to photograph, to depict).

Noun[edit]

مُصَوِّر (muṣawwirm (plural مُصَوِّرُون (muṣawwirūn), feminine مُصَوِّرَة (muṣawwira))

  1. photographer
  2. cameraman
  3. creator, shaper
  4. illustrator
  5. painter

Proper noun[edit]

المُصَوِّر (al-muṣawwirm

  1. (Islam) one of the beautiful Names of God, "the Shaper, the Fashioner"
    • 609–632 CE, Qur'an, 59:24:
      هُوَ اللَّهُ الْخَالِقُ الْبَارِئُ الْمُصَوِّرُ لَهُ الْأَسْمَاءُ الْحُسْنَى يُسَبِّحُ لَهُ مَا فِي السَّمَاوَاتِ وَالْأَرْضِ وَهُوَ الْعَزِيزُ الْحَكِيمُ
      huwa l-lahu l-ḵāliqu l-bāriʔu l-muṣawwiru lahu l-ʔasmāʔu l-ḥusnā yusabbiḥu lahu mā fī s-samāwāti wālʔarḍi wahuwa l-ʕazīzu l-ḥakīmu
      He is Allah, the Creator, the Inventor, the Fashioner; to Him belong the best names. Whatever is in the heavens and earth is exalting Him. And He is the Exalted in Might, the Wise.

Etymology 2[edit]

Root
ص و ر (ṣ-w-r)

Derived from the passive participle of صَوَّرَ (ṣawwara, to photograph, to depict).

Noun[edit]

مُصَوَّر (muṣawwar) (feminine مُصَوَّرَة (muṣawwara), masculine plural مُصَوَّرُونَ (muṣawwarūna), feminine plural مُصَوَّرَات (muṣawwarāt))

  1. illustrated

Etymology 4[edit]

Root
ص و ر (ṣ-w-r)

Noun of place of صَوَّرَ (ṣawwara, to photograph, to depict).

Noun[edit]

مُصَوَّر (muṣawwarm (plural مُصَوَّرَات (muṣawwarāt))

  1. photography studio
